Abstract

Urticaria has many known etiologies. An association with autoimmune thyroid disease is described. One individual had the triad of urticaria, Hashimoto's thyroiditis, and rheumatoid arthritis, whereas the other individual had urticaria preceding Graves' disease by over 1 year.
